About Shukor Baljit & Partners

Shukor Baljit & Partners appears in 10 reported Malaysia judgments (2025–2026). These were heard before MYHC (9) and MYCOA (1).

On the court record

Shukor Baljit & Partners appears in the reported judgments as a civil, construction and commercial-litigation practice, working mainly in the High Court (Mahkamah Tinggi) with a matter in the Court of Appeal (Mahkamah Rayuan) and appearing most often for defendants and respondents. Civil procedure is the most frequent theme in its corpus, including the assessment of damages on an undertaking as to damages given when an interlocutory injunction was granted, and a striking-out application against a claim founded on conspiracy. The firm also appears in arbitration, including an application to set aside an arbitral award under section 37(1)(a)(vi) and section 37(1)(b) of the Arbitration Act 2005, in a matter involving the Government of Malaysia. Its statutory-law and insolvency work includes a claim by the Employees Provident Fund against an association over contributions, and a company winding-up petition under sections 465(1)(e) and 466(1)(a) of the Companies Act 2016 in a matter involving an Islamic bank. Construction and negligence feature as well, including a claim that a party failed to exercise reasonable care during construction works and the duty of care owed, and the firm has appeared in an application for a stay of a decision of the Kuala Lumpur City Hall granting a development order. Its work also extends to interim injunctive relief pending the disposal of a suit, including a matter involving the communications and multimedia regulator. The counterparties in the corpus include statutory bodies, banks, construction companies and a football association. Acting predominantly for defendants and respondents, the firm presents as a litigator whose corpus centres on civil procedure, arbitration set-aside, insolvency and construction-negligence work, together with the administrative and injunction questions that arise around development approvals and regulatory action. The arbitration set-aside matter is a significant strand, since the grounds on which a court may set aside an award under section 37 of the Arbitration Act 2005 are deliberately narrow, and a party seeking to overturn an award must bring itself within one of them rather than reargue the merits.
